Exact 2015 GMC Acadia 3.6 Oil Capacity

For the 3.6L V6 engine in the 2015 GMC Acadia, the standard oil capacity is 6 quarts (or approximately 5.7 liters) when performing an oil and filter change.

It is always good practice to verify this information with your owner’s manual, as minor variations can sometimes occur, or to account for any specific maintenance history your vehicle might have. When adding oil, it’s recommended to add slightly less than the full capacity (e.g., 5.5 quarts), then start the engine, let it run for a minute, shut it off, wait a few minutes for the oil to settle, and then check the dipstick. Add small amounts as needed until the oil level registers between the “add” and “full” marks on the dipstick. Never overfill the engine, as this can cause foaming, decreased lubrication effectiveness, and potential damage to seals and other components.

Selecting the Right Oil Type for Your 2015 GMC Acadia 3.6L

Choosing the correct oil type is just as important as ensuring the proper capacity. The 3.6L V6 engine in the 2015 Acadia has specific requirements that must be met to guarantee proper function and protection.

1. Viscosity Grade: SAE 5W-30
The primary recommendation for the 2015 GMC Acadia 3.6L engine is SAE 5W-30 viscosity motor oil.
The “5W” indicates its performance in cold weather (W for winter), meaning it flows like a 5-weight oil at low temperatures, crucial for cold starts and rapid lubrication in winter conditions.
The “30” indicates its viscosity at operating temperature, providing the necessary thickness to protect engine components under normal driving conditions.

2. API Certification and Dexos1 Specification
Beyond viscosity, the oil must meet specific industry standards. For your 2015 Acadia, it’s imperative to use an oil that meets the dexos1™ Gen 2 specification.
API Certification: Look for the “starburst” symbol on the oil container, indicating it meets the American Petroleum Institute’s (API) current service category (e.g., SN Plus or SP). This ensures it meets modern performance and protection standards.
dexos1™ Gen 2: This is a proprietary engine oil specification developed by General Motors specifically for their gasoline engines. It’s designed to provide enhanced protection against:
Low-Speed Pre-Ignition (LSPI): A critical issue in modern direct-injected, turbocharged engines (even naturally aspirated direct-injection engines like the LFX benefit).
Turbocharger coking.
Wear.
Sludge formation.
Improved fuel economy.

Using a non-dexos1 certified oil, even if it has the correct viscosity, can compromise engine protection and potentially void your powertrain warranty. Always look for the official dexos1 logo on the oil bottle.

3. Conventional, Synthetic Blend, or Full Synthetic?
While the owner’s manual typically specifies a “synthetic blend” or “full synthetic” oil that meets the dexos1 standard, opting for a full synthetic dexos1 Gen 2 certified 5W-30 oil is generally the best choice for maximum protection and extended drain intervals. Full synthetic oils offer superior performance in extreme temperatures, better resistance to breakdown, and often lead to cleaner engines over time. Given the advanced nature of the 3.6L V6, the slightly higher cost of full synthetic is a worthwhile investment.

The Importance of Regular Oil Changes

Following the recommended oil change intervals is paramount. The 2015 GMC Acadia is equipped with an Oil Life Monitoring System (OLMS), which calculates when an oil change is due based on factors like engine revolutions, operating temperature, and driving conditions.
Typically, the system will recommend an oil change between 7,500 to 10,000 miles (12,000 to 16,000 km), or approximately once a year, whichever comes first.
However, if your driving habits include frequent short trips, extensive idling, towing, or driving in very dusty or extreme temperature conditions, the OLMS might recommend an earlier oil change.

Ignoring the OLMS or stretching oil change intervals can lead to oil degradation, reduced lubrication, and the buildup of sludge and deposits, which can severely damage engine components and reduce fuel efficiency.
